Taxus baccata 125-150 CM SPIRAL C45
Taxus baccata (English yew) is a slow-growing, evergreen conifer renowned for its dense, dark green needles and exceptional response to clipping, making it a classic choice for topiary. This spiral form provides year-round structure and a striking focal point for formal or contemporary designs. Yew thrives in full sun to deep shade and is adaptable to a wide range of soils, including chalk, clay and sand, provided they are well-drained. Suitable for containers or open ground, it is fully hardy and maintains its crisp outline with periodic trimming.
